'SCHOLARSHIP DAYS' ARE FEB. 9-10
Students who have applied for scholarships to attend Old Dominion University will compete for aid during the university's Scholarship Days Saturday and Sunday, Feb. 9-10.
Students with 3.25 grade point averages and 1,100 on the SAT were invited to attend either date. By attending, each student is guaranteed a one-time $1,500 scholarship and is competing for up to a four-year, full-ride scholarship.
The university annually awards more than 350 merit-based scholarships worth $6.5 million based on students' admissions applications. To be eligible, students in December 2001 submitted applications including their high school transcripts and standardized test scores. Their community involvement plays a part in the determination process.
